Mako SmartRobotics™ joint replacement procedures

Muskegon Surgery Center is the first surgery center in Michigan to offer three different procedures — total hip, partial knee and total knee — using the Mako Robotic-Arm Assisted Surgery System. Seven of our surgeons are trained and certified to perform surgery using Stryker’s Mako System.

Expanding to meet our patients needs

We have completed a major expansion of the facility, our second large expansion in five years. This new 13,498 square foot addition represents a $9.3 million investment and includes two larger operating rooms equipped with state-of-the-art Stryker OR technology as well as more space for sterile processing.
